Ok so I have this Dubia colony going ... well while checking them I notice a female with what I would assume would be her egg case sticking out her back side so I was like cool they are mating and I should have some tiny roaches to feed to my chams soon ... well its been like 2 weeks and I can't find a single tiny roach ... am I doing some thing wrong? They have tons of food so I doubt they ate the little ones ...
 
when I started my dubia colony I didn't think it was ever going to start growing because I never saw any babies but then all of a sudden there was hundreds more than I started out with. The babies may be hiding in the poop. I'm sure you will notice more really soon.
 
It takes my dubias several months after being moved to a new tub to start really producing. Perhaps I keep mine cooler than most people much of the year though...
 
The female will produce an egg case and then they pull it back into their body where it gestates. They will give birth about one month later.
